Run the filtercheck.exe in the GB-PVR directory and I'll tell you what the entry in bda.ini should look like.

I got this:
Code:
19:06:24.437    INFO    Checking KSCATEGORY_BDA_NETWORK_TUNER filters
19:06:24.452    INFO    found: TerraTec T5 Digital Tuner (Dev1 Path0)
19:06:24.468    INFO     - (input)  Input0
19:06:24.468    INFO     - (output) MPEG2-Transport
19:06:24.468    INFO    
19:06:24.468    INFO    found: TerraTec T5 Digital Tuner (Dev1 Path1)
19:06:24.468    INFO     - (input)  Input0
19:06:24.468    INFO     - (output) MPEG2-Transport
19:06:24.468    INFO    
19:06:24.468    INFO    
19:06:24.468    INFO    
19:06:24.468    INFO    Checking KSCATEGORY_BDA_RECEIVER_COMPONENT filters
19:06:24.483    INFO    found: BDA Slip De-Framer
19:06:24.499    INFO     - (input)  NABTS
19:06:24.499    INFO     - (output) IPv4
19:06:24.499    INFO    
19:06:24.515    INFO    found: BDA MPE-Filter
19:06:24.546    INFO     - (input)  MPE
19:06:24.546    INFO     - (output) IPv4
19:06:24.546    INFO    
19:06:24.562    INFO    found: TerraTec T5 Digital Capture (Dev1 Path0)
19:06:24.593    INFO     - (input)  MPEG2-Transport
19:06:24.593    INFO     - (output) MPEG2-Transport
19:06:24.593    INFO    
19:06:24.593    INFO    found: TerraTec T5 Digital Capture (Dev1 Path1)
19:06:24.593    INFO     - (input)  MPEG2-Transport
19:06:24.593    INFO     - (output) MPEG2-Transport
19:06:24.593    INFO

And I added this to bda.ini, right?

Code:
[TerraTec T5 Path0]
TUNING_TYPE=DVB-T
FILTER_TUNER=TerraTec T5 Digital Tuner (Dev1 Path0)
FILTER_CAPTURE=TerraTec T5 Digital Capture (Dev1 Path0)
PIN_TUNER_IN=Input0
PIN_TUNER_OUT=MPEG2-Transport
PIN_CAPTURE_IN=MPEG2-Transport
PIN_CAPTURE_OUT=MPEG2-Transport

[TerraTec T5 Path1]
TUNING_TYPE=DVB-T
FILTER_TUNER=TerraTec T5 Digital Tuner (Dev1 Path1)
FILTER_CAPTURE=TerraTec T5 Digital Capture (Dev1 Path1)
PIN_TUNER_IN=Input0
PIN_TUNER_OUT=MPEG2-Transport
PIN_CAPTURE_IN=MPEG2-Transport
PIN_CAPTURE_OUT=MPEG2-Transport

Can you zip and attach your filtercheck.log? Dont paste the contents of it into the post. Some times these devices that have "(Dev1 Path0)" in the name have a space at the end of the name, and this needs to be included (use quotes around the whole name including space)
